2.Cytomegalovirus ventriculoencephalitis in patients without acquired immune deficiency syndrome: a case report
Jiayi LI ; Siyuan FAN ; Hongzhi GUAN
Journal of Apoplexy and Nervous Diseases 2024;41(2):116-118
		                        		
		                        			
		                        			Cytomegalovirus(CMV)ventriculoencephalitis is a type of severe encephalitis caused by CMV infection of the ependyma and brain parenchyma,with the main clinical manifestations of fever,headache,disturbance of consciousness,and convulsions. The opportunistic infection of CMV often occurs in immunocompromised people,mainly in patients with acquired immune deficiency syndrome(AIDS),while nervous system infection is extremely rare in people with competent immune function. This article reports a case of CMV ventriculoencephalitis in a non-AIDS young male patient,with pyrexia and disturbance of consciousness as the initial presentation. Contrast-enhanced magnetic resonance imaging showed a typical enhanced signal shadow of the ventriculomeninges,and a confirmed diagnosis was made based on cerebrospinal fluid CMV examination. We hope that this case of non-AIDS-related CMV ventriculoencephalitis will provide help for clinicians to improve their understanding of the clinical and imaging manifestations of this disease.

4.Pathological Types,Expression of Mismatch Repair Protein,Human Epidermal Growth Factor Receptor 2,and Pan-TRK,and Eostein-Barr Virus Infection in Patients With Colorectal Cancer Resected in Tibet.
Han-Huan LUO ; Zhen HUO ; BIANBAZHAXI ; Qian WANG ; DUOBULA ; NIMAZHUOMA ; Zhen DA ; Ping-Ping GUO
Acta Academiae Medicinae Sinicae 2023;45(3):422-428
		                        		
		                        			
		                        			Objective To study the pathological types,expression of mismatch repair protein,human epidermal growth factor receptor 2(HER2),and Pan-TRK,and Epstein-Barr virus(EBV)infection in patients with colorectal cancer resected in Tibet. Methods A total of 79 patients with colorectal cancer resected in Tibet Autonomous Region People's Hospital from December 2013 to July 2021 were enrolled in this study.The clinical and pathological data of the patients were collected.The expression of mismatch repair protein,HER2,and Pan-TRK was detected by immunohistochemical(IHC)staining,and detection of HER2 gene by fluorescence in situ hybridization(FISH)in the patients with HER2 IHC results of 2+ or above.EBV was detected by in situ hybridization with EBV-encoded small RNA. Results A total of 79 colorectal cancer patients were included in this study,with the male-to-female ratio of 1.26:1 and the mean age of(57.06±12.74)years(24-83 years).Among them,4 patients received preoperative neoadjuvant therapy.Colonic cancer and rectal cancer occurred in 57(57/79,72.15%,including 31 and 26 in the right colon and left colon,respectively)and 22(22/79,27.85%)patients,respectively.The maximum diameter of tumor varied within the range of 1-20 cm,with the mean of(6.61±3.33)cm.Among the 79 colorectal cancer patients,75(75/79,94.94%)patients showed adenocarcinoma.Lymph node metastasis occurred in 12(12/21,57.14%)out of the 21 patients with severe tumor budding,13(13/23,56.52%)out of the 23 patients with moderate tumor budding,and 2(2/31,6.45%)out of the 31 patients with mild tumor budding,respectively.The lymph node metastasis rate showed differences between the patients with severe/moderate tumor budding and the patients with mild tumor budding(all P<0.001).The IHC staining showed that mismatch repair protein was negative in 10(10/65,15.38%)patients,including 5 patients with both MSH2 and MSH6 negative,4 patients with both MLH1 and PMS2 negative,and 1 patient with MSH6 negative.Pan-TRK was negative in 65 patients.The IHC results of HER2 showed 0 or 1+ in 60 patients and 2+ in 5 patients.FISH showed no positive signal in the 5 patients with HER2 IHC results of 2+.The detection with EBV-encoded small RNA showed positive result in 1(1/65,1.54%)patient. Conclusions Non-specific adenocarcinoma of the right colon is the most common in the patients with colorectal cancer resected in Tibet,and 15% of the patients showed mismatch repair protein defects.EBV-associated colorectal carcer is rare,Pan-TRK expression and HER2 gene amplification are seldom.The colorectal cancer patients with moderate and severe tumor budding are more likely to have lymph node metastasis.

5.Hemophagocytic Syndrome Secondary to Human Parvovirus B19 Infection in an Acquired Immunodeficiency Syndrome Patient:Report of One Case.
Yan ZHANG ; Jun YAN ; Fei WANG ; Jin GAO ; Kai-Long GU ; Ai-Fang XU
Acta Academiae Medicinae Sinicae 2023;45(3):530-532
		                        		
		                        			
		                        			The acquired immunodeficiency syndrome patients with compromised immunity are prone to hemophagocytic syndrome secondary to opportunistic infections.This paper reports a rare case of hemophagocytic syndrome secondary to human parvovirus B19 infection in an acquired immunodeficiency syndrome patient,and analyzes the clinical characteristics,aiming to improve the diagnosis and treatment of the disease and prevent missed diagnosis and misdiagnosis.

6.Clinical Study of Cytomegalovirus Infection after Allogeneic Hematopoietic Stem Cell Transplantation.
Yi-Ying XIONG ; Lin LIU ; Jian-Bin CHEN ; Xiao-Qiong TANG ; Qing XIAO ; Hong-Bin ZHANG ; Li WANG
Journal of Experimental Hematology 2023;31(2):513-521
		                        		
		                        			OBJECTIVE:
		                        			To explore the risk factors of cytomegalovirus (CMV) and refractory CMV infection (RCI) after allogeneic hematopoietic stem cell transplantation (allo-HSCT) and their influences on survival.
		                        		
		                        			METHODS:
		                        			A total of 246 patients who received allo-HSCT from 2015 to 2020 were divided into CMV group (n=67) and non-CMV group (n=179) according to whether they had CMV infection. Patients with CMV infection were further divided into RCI group (n=18) and non-RCI group (n=49) according to whether they had RCI. The risk factors of CMV infection and RCI were analyzed, and the diagnostic significance of Logistics regression model was verified by ROC curve. The differences of overall survival (OS) and progression-free survival (PFS) between groups and the risk factors affecting OS were analyzed.
		                        		
		                        			RESULTS:
		                        			For patients with CMV infection, the median time of the first CMV infection was 48(7-183) days after allo-HSCT, and the median duration was 21 (7-158) days. Older age, EB viremia and gradeⅡ-Ⅳacute graft-versus-host disease (aGVHD) significantly increased the risk of CMV infection (P=0.032, <0.001 and 0.037, respectively). Risk factors for RCI were EB viremia and the peak value of CMV-DNA at diagnosis≥1×104 copies/ml (P=0.039 and 0.006, respectively). White blood cell (WBC)≥4×109/L at 14 days after transplantation was a protective factor for CMV infection and RCI (P=0.013 and 0.014, respectively). The OS rate in CMV group was significantly lower than that in non-CMV group (P=0.033), and also significantly lower in RCI group than that in non-RCI group (P=0.043). Hematopoietic reconstruction was a favorable factor for OS (P<0.001), whereas CMV-DNA≥1.0×104 copies/ml within 60 days after transplantation was a risk factor for OS (P=0.005).
		                        		
		                        			CONCLUSION
		                        			The late recovery of WBC and the combination of EB viremia after transplantation are common risk factors for CMV infection and RCI. CMV-DNA load of 1×104 copies/ml is an important threshold, higher than which is associated with higher RCI and lower OS risk.

7.Comparative Analysis of Primary and Reactivated EB Virus Infection Associated Hemophagocytic Lymphohistiocytosis.
Jiang-Hua LIU ; Wei LIU ; Yan-Ge LI
Journal of Experimental Hematology 2023;31(2):575-580
		                        		
		                        			OBJECTIVE:
		                        			To compare the clinical characteristics of children with hemophagocytic lymphocytosis (HLH) associated with primary Epstein-Barr virus (EBV) infection and EBV reactivation, and explore the effects of different EBV infection status on the clinical indexes and prognosis of HLH.
		                        		
		                        			METHODS:
		                        			The clinical data of 51 children with EBV associated HLH treated in Henan Children's Hospital from June 2016 to June 2021 were collected. According to the detection results of plasma EBV antibody spectrum, they were divided into EBV primary infection-associated HLH group (18 cases) and EBV reactivation-associated HLH group (33 cases). The clinical features, laboratory indexes and prognosis of the two groups were analyzed and compared.
		                        		
		                        			RESULTS:
		                        			There were no significant differences in age, gender, hepatomegaly, splenomegaly, lymphadenopathy, neutrophil count in peripheral blood, hemoglobin content, platelet count, plasma EBV-DNA load, lactate dehydrogenase, alanine aminotransferase, aspartate aminotransferase, albumin, fibrinogen, triglyceride, ferritin, hemophagocytosis in bone marrow, NK cell activity and sCD25 between the two groups(P>0.05). The central nervous system involvement and CD4/CD8 in EBV reactivation-associated HLH group were significantly higher than those in primary infection-associated HLH group, but the total bilirubin was significantly lower than that in primary infection-associated HLH group (P<0.05). After treatment according to HLH-2004 protocol, the remission rate, 5-year OS rate and 5-year EFS rate of patients in EBV reactivation-associated HLH group were significantly lower than those in EBV primary infection-associated HLH group (P<0.05).
		                        		
		                        			CONCLUSION
		                        			EBV reactivation-associated HLH is more likely to cause central nervous system involvement and the prognosis is worser than EBV primary infection-associated HLH, which requires intensive treatment.

8.Inflammatory granuloma of the trachea: a rare case with Epstin-Barr virus infection.
Zhaodi WANG ; Xuan LU ; Yunmei YANG ; Yuanqiang LU
Journal of Zhejiang University. Science. B 2023;24(6):539-543
		                        		
		                        			
		                        			Epstein-Barr virus (EBV), a double-stranded DNA virus with an envelope, is a ubiquitous pathogen that is prevalent in humans, although most people who contract it do not develop symptoms (Kerr, 2019). While the primary cells EBV attacks are epithelial cells and B lymphocytes, its target range expands to a variety of cell types in immunodeficient hosts. Serological change occurs in 90% of infected patients. Therefore, immunoglobulin M (IgM) and IgG, serologically reactive to viral capsid antigens, are reliable biomarkers for the detection of acute and chronic EBV infections (Cohen, 2000). Symptoms of EBV infection vary according to age and immune status. Young patients with primary infection may present with infectious mononucleosis; there is a typical triad of symptoms including fever, angina, and lymphadenectasis (Houen and Trier, 2021). In immunocompromised patients, response after EBV infection may be atypical, with unexplained fever. The nucleic acid of EBV can be detected to confirm whether high-risk patients are infected (Smets et al., 2000). EBV is also associated with the occurrence of certain tumors (such as lymphoma and nasopharyngeal carcinoma) because it transforms host cells (Shannon-Lowe et al., 2017; Tsao et al., 2017).

9.Research progress of human bocavirus infection in children.
Chinese Critical Care Medicine 2023;35(5):548-553
		                        		
		                        			
		                        			Human bocavirus is a novel pathogen first detected in respiratory tract samples in 2005. People of different ages can be infected by human bocavirus. Children are the susceptible population, especially the infants aged from 6-24 months old. The epidemic season varies in different regions due to the differences in climate and geographical location, and it mainly occurs in autumn and winter. It's demonstrated that human bocavirus-1 is closely related to respiratory system diseases and even causes life-threatening critical illness. Also, the severity of symptom is positively correlated with viral load. Co-infections between human bocavirus-1 and other viruses often present high frequency occurrence. Human bocavirus-1 interferes immune function of host by inhibiting interferon secrete pathway. Currently, it remains limited knowledge and understanding of the roles of human bocavirus 2-4 in diseases, but the gastrointestinal diseases should be paid more attention. Detection of human bocavirus DNA by traditional polymerase chain reaction (PCR) assay shouldn't be regarded as conclusive diagnostic basis. Instead, combined with mRNA and specific antigen detection, it is beneficial to improve the accuracy of diagnosis. Till now, the knowledge of human bocavirus remains poorly studied, which is deserved to further progress.

10.The Chinese herbal prescription JieZe-1 inhibits caspase-1-dependent pyroptosis induced by herpes simplex virus-2 infection in vitro.
Tong LIU ; Qing-Qing SHAO ; Wen-Jia WANG ; Tian-Li LIU ; Xi-Ming JIN ; Li-Jun XU ; Guang-Ying HUANG ; Zhuo CHEN
Journal of Integrative Medicine 2023;21(3):277-288
		                        		
		                        			OBJECTIVE:
		                        			JieZe-1 (JZ-1), a Chinese herbal prescription, has an obvious effect on genital herpes, which is mainly caused by herpes simplex virus type 2 (HSV-2). Our study aimed to address whether HSV-2 induces pyroptosis of VK2/E6E7 cells and to investigate the anti-HSV-2 activity of JZ-1 and the effect of JZ-1 on caspase-1-dependent pyroptosis.
		                        		
		                        			METHODS:
		                        			HSV-2-infected VK2/E6E7 cells and culture supernate were harvested at different time points after the infection. Cells were co-treated with HSV-2 and penciclovir (0.078125 mg/mL) or caspase-1 inhibitor VX-765 (24 h pretreatment with 100 μmol/L) or JZ-1 (0.078125-50 mg/mL). Cell counting kit-8 assay and viral load analysis were used to evaluate the antiviral activity of JZ-1. Inflammasome activation and pyroptosis of VK2/E6E7 cells were analyzed using microscopy, Hoechst 33342/propidium iodide staining, lactate dehydrogenase release assay, gene and protein expression, co-immunoprecipitation, immunofluorescence, and enzyme-linked immunosorbent assay.
		                        		
		                        			RESULTS:
		                        			HSV-2 induced pyroptosis of VK2/E6E7 cells, with the most significant increase observed 24 h after the infection. JZ-1 effectively inhibited HSV-2 (the 50% inhibitory concentration = 1.709 mg/mL), with the 6.25 mg/mL dose showing the highest efficacy (95.76%). JZ-1 (6.25 mg/mL) suppressed pyroptosis of VK2/E6E7 cells. It downregulated the inflammasome activation and pyroptosis via inhibiting the expression of nucleotide-binding oligomerization domain-like receptor family pyrin domain-containing protein 3 (P < 0.001) and interferon-γ-inducible protein 16 (P < 0.001), and their interactions with apoptosis-associated speck-like protein containing a caspase recruitment domain, and reducing cleaved caspase-1 p20 (P < 0.01), gasdermin D-N (P < 0.01), interleukin (IL)-1β (P < 0.001), and IL-18 levels (P < 0.001).
		                        		
		                        			CONCLUSION
		                        			JZ-1 exerts an excellent anti-HSV-2 effect in VK2/E6E7 cells, and it inhibits caspase-1-dependent pyroptosis induced by HSV-2 infection. These data enrich our understanding of the pathologic basis of HSV-2 infection and provide experimental evidence for the anti-HSV-2 activity of JZ-1.
